§ 41-51-19. Location of plants

Universal Citation: MS Code § 41-51-19 (2019)
  • No new plant shall be located or constructed, or any discontinued plant reconstructed or reopened, at any place in this state inside of, or within two (2) miles of the nearest point of, the existing corporate limits of any municipality with a population in excess of five hundred (500) according to the latest federal census, or within one (1) mile of the nearest boundary of the lands owned or controlled in connection either with any state, county, township, city or town park, or boulevard, or of any public school or hospital, or of any charitable, religious or educational institution.
  • Any existing plant which shall, on March 26, 1964, be in operation upon a site located in, or within the distance aforesaid from, any of the places or objects designated in this section shall not be denied a license solely by reason of its location.
